Design System
Ultimate Guide to the PayPal Design System for Seamless Payment Experiences
Author
Staff writer
Visulry
Article

On this page

As our lives become more connected online, how we manage payments can significantly influence user experiences.

The PayPal Design System not only enhances the visual appeal of transactions but also prioritizes clarity and security to foster trust among users.

By understanding its core elements and principles, you can transform payment interactions into seamless and satisfying experiences.

Understand the Core Elements of the PayPal Design System

When it comes to creating seamless payment experiences, PayPal has developed a design system that really sets the standard. At its heart, the PayPal Design System combines functionality and aesthetics to ensure that users have a smooth, engaging experience every time they interact with the platform. This system isn't just about making things look good; it’s about enhancing usability and reinforcing brand identity. By focusing on key elements like typography, color and motion, PayPal is able to communicate its brand values while making the payment process intuitive and hassle-free.

One of the standout features of this design system is how it emphasizes clarity and consistency across various platforms. Whether you're using the PayPal app on your phone or accessing it through a web browser, you’ll notice that the design elements work together cohesively. This attention to detail is what helps build trust with users, making them feel secure and confident in their transactions.

Explore PayPal Pro Typeface and Typography Standards

An essential component of the PayPal Design System is the PayPal Pro typeface. This typeface, which is a customized version of LL Supreme, has been crafted to embody a modern and approachable aesthetic. It reflects the brand’s commitment to simplicity and clarity. When you look at PayPal’s communications, whether it's their website, app or marketing materials, you’ll see how this typeface is used consistently to convey messages in a way that is both legible and inviting.

Typography is key in directing user attention and improving readability. The PayPal Pro typeface is crafted so that headers, body text and call-to-action buttons are easily noticeable without being too much for the user. This careful design not only reinforces the brand's identity but also allows users to navigate through information smoothly and without confusion.

Apply the Streamlined Color Palette Effectively

Color is another pivotal aspect of the PayPal Design System. The streamlined color palette has been carefully chosen to reflect the brand's values while promoting an energetic and optimistic vibe. By using neutral blacks and whites as the primary colors, with shades of blue as accents, PayPal has created a visual identity that is both striking and functional. The absence of yellow, which could easily lead to confusion with retail brands, is a strategic decision that helps maintain PayPal's unique presence in the financial technology space.

Implementing this color palette effectively means understanding how color impacts user perception and behavior. Each hue is chosen not just for its visual appeal, but also for how it can evoke emotions and guide users through their payment journey. A well-placed pop of blue can draw attention to key actions, while the use of neutral tones allows for a clean, uncluttered interface that feels professional and trustworthy.

Utilize Motion Language Based on Payment Behaviors

Motion is an often-overlooked aspect of design systems, but PayPal truly gets its significance. The motion language used in the PayPal Design System draws inspiration from everyday payment gestures, such as tapping, swiping and flipping. This not only enhances the interactivity of the interface but also aligns the user experience with familiar real-world actions, making it feel more intuitive.

When users engage with PayPal, the motions that accompany their actions provide immediate feedback, enhancing the overall experience. For instance, a smooth transition when confirming a payment not only feels satisfying but also reassures users that their transaction is being processed. By integrating these types of motions, PayPal creates a sense of fluidity and ease that is essential for fostering user trust and satisfaction.

In essence, the core elements of the PayPal Design System work together harmoniously to create a payment experience that is not only efficient but also reflective of the brand's ethos.

Implement PayPal Design System in Your Payment Interfaces

When it comes to designing effective payment interfaces, using the PayPal Design System can really make a difference. It’s not just about how things look; it’s also about creating a smooth experience for users. With the right tools and processes, you can develop interfaces that are both visually appealing and highly functional, allowing users to navigate their payment options with ease.

One of the key innovations in this space is the integration of UXPin Merge technology. This powerful tool allows you to seamlessly blend design and development, ensuring that the components you create in design mirror what developers will implement. This alignment helps to eliminate miscommunication and speeds up the entire process, letting your team focus on what really matters: delivering exceptional experiences.

Integrate UI Components with UXPin Merge Technology

Integrating UI components using UXPin Merge technology is a straightforward yet impactful step in implementing the PayPal Design System. With Merge, you can pull in design elements directly from your existing libraries, like Microsoft’s Fluent design system, which PayPal utilizes. This means that when designers create components in UXPin, they are using the exact same elements that developers will work with. The beauty of this approach lies in its ability to maintain design consistency across the board.

By rendering components in the design editor that are identical to the developers' UI controls, Merge significantly reduces the time spent on handoffs. Designers can create high-fidelity prototypes that include interactive states, allowing for a more realistic representation of the final product. This not only enhances the design process but also ensures that the vision is clearly communicated to everyone involved.

Ensure High-Fidelity Prototyping from Design to Development

High-fidelity prototyping is essential in bridging the gap between design and development. With UXPin Merge, PayPal designers have seen a remarkable increase in their productivity. Prototypes can be built nearly eight times faster compared to traditional vector tools. This rapid prototyping capability empowers designers to iterate quickly based on feedback, thereby enhancing the overall quality of the product.

A high-fidelity prototype is invaluable because it allows stakeholders, including product managers and engineers, to visualize the final product more accurately. This clarity helps in securing buy-in from various teams and ensures that everyone is on the same page. When you can show an interactive prototype that closely resembles the end product, you invite more meaningful feedback, which can lead to better design decisions.

Collaborate Effectively Between Designers and Developers

Collaboration between designers and developers plays a key role in successfully implementing the PayPal Design System. In the past, designers often worked alone before passing their designs off to developers, which frequently resulted in misunderstandings and misalignments. By using tools like UXPin Merge, teams can engage more collaboratively throughout the entire design process.

Creating an environment where designers and developers engage with each other regularly can significantly improve communication. For example, involving developers early in the design discussions allows them to share insights about technical feasibility and constraints. This collaborative approach not only fosters a sense of teamwork but also leads to better outcomes, as everyone feels invested in the project.

With the PayPal Design System and tools like UXPin Merge, you can create a more seamless workflow that strengthens the connection between design and development. This leads to a smoother implementation process and a more refined product that effectively meets user needs.

Design Seamless Payment Experiences Using PayPal’s System

When it comes to creating a seamless payment experience, PayPal's design system provides a solid foundation. The goal is to keep transactions smooth and intuitive for users while ensuring that everything runs behind the scenes efficiently. This involves not just the visual design but also the logical flow of how payments are processed, which can significantly impact user satisfaction. By integrating PayPal’s design principles, you can craft an experience that feels both reliable and user-friendly.

One important part of this design is clearly outlining the flow of payments in and out. It’s vital to visualize how money travels from the buyer to the seller and back to the platform. This transparency helps minimize friction, making the experience feel seamless for users. When users start a payment, they should feel supported at every step, whether they're selecting their payment method or confirming the transaction. The process for sellers to receive their payouts should be just as simple. By making it easy for users to understand their place in the payment journey, you can really improve their overall experience.

Map Out the Pay-In and Pay-Out Flows Clearly

Mapping out the pay-in and pay-out flows is like creating a roadmap for your users. For the pay-in flow, start by outlining the journey a customer takes when they make a purchase. They should effortlessly transition from product selection to payment confirmation. Think of every element they interact with: buttons, forms, and prompts, and ensure they all lead logically to the next step. The same applies to the pay-out flow for sellers. They need assurance that once a sale is made, their money will reach them quickly and securely. Clearly defined flows reduce confusion and build trust, making users feel more comfortable completing their transactions.

Leverage Double-Entry Ledger Principles for Accuracy

Next up is leveraging double-entry ledger principles. This accounting method is a cornerstone of financial transactions and ensures that every transaction is recorded accurately and transparently. By applying these principles, you can maintain a high level of integrity in your payment system. For each payment made, there’s a corresponding entry that balances the books, ensuring that you can trace the source and destination of funds effortlessly. This not only helps in preventing errors and fraud but also provides peace of mind to users knowing their transactions are secure and well-accounted for.

Incorporate Hosted Payment Pages for Compliance and Security

Incorporating hosted payment pages is another key step in designing a seamless payment experience. These pages allow you to handle transactions without directly managing sensitive card data, which can significantly enhance your security posture. By redirecting users to the payment service provider's (PSP) page, you alleviate the burden of compliance with regulations like PCI DSS. This not only protects your business from potential security breaches but also builds trust with users. They can feel confident knowing their payment information is handled by a secure and compliant third party.

Handle Payment Failures and Ensure Exactly-Once Delivery

Handling payment failures effectively is key to ensuring a good user experience. It's natural for some transactions to run into problems, whether because of network glitches or payment rejections. What really counts is how you address these issues. Having a clear plan for retrying transactions and ensuring that deliveries happen exactly once can help reduce user frustration. It's important to keep users informed about the status of their transactions by providing updates and options when things go awry. By being transparent and offering solutions, you can turn what could be a negative experience into a positive one, encouraging users to come back for future transactions.

Designing seamless payment experiences using PayPal’s system is all about clarity, security and responsiveness. By focusing on these elements, you'll not only enhance user satisfaction but also ensure your payment system runs smoothly and efficiently.

Optimize PayPal Design System for Scalability and Performance

When it comes to building a payment system as strong as PayPal's, scalability and performance are essential. With online transactions increasing at a rapid pace, it’s important to ensure that your design system can manage rising demands without sacrificing speed or reliability. This is where careful architecture and design principles come into play. By concentrating on the right strategies and technologies, you can create a smooth payment experience that evolves along with your business needs.

One of the most effective ways to achieve scalability is by adopting microservices and event-driven architectures. Rather than relying on a monolithic structure where everything is interconnected, microservices allow you to break down your payment system into smaller, more manageable components. Each service can handle a specific function, like processing transactions or managing user authentication. This means that if one service needs to scale up due to increased demand, it can do so independently without affecting the entire system. Pairing this with an event-driven approach allows your system to react to real-time events, making it more responsive and efficient.

Adopt Microservices and Event-Driven Architectures

Microservices play a significant role in enhancing the scalability of PayPal’s design system. Each microservice can be developed, deployed and scaled independently. For instance, if you notice a surge in payment transactions during a holiday sale, you can allocate more resources specifically to the payment processing service without having to overhaul the entire system. This targeted approach not only boosts performance but also enhances fault tolerance. If one service encounters an issue, the others can continue operating smoothly, ensuring that the overall system remains functional.

Event-driven architectures complement this structure perfectly. By using message queues and event streams, your services can communicate asynchronously. This means when a payment is initiated, the service can publish an event to the queue, allowing other services to react to that event at their own pace. The result is a system that can handle spikes in traffic more gracefully and maintain a responsive user experience.

Implement Effective Load Balancing and Database Strategies

Effective load balancing is an essential part of optimizing your payment system. Load balancers help spread incoming traffic across several servers, so no single server gets overloaded. This not only boosts overall performance but also makes your payment system more reliable. When load balancing is done well, users can enjoy minimal delays, even during busy transaction periods.

Database strategies also play a vital role in maintaining performance. Utilizing a combination of SQL and NoSQL databases can provide the best of both worlds. SQL databases are excellent for structured transactional data that require strong consistency, while NoSQL databases can efficiently handle high-velocity event logging and analytics. Sharding your databases can further enhance performance by distributing data across multiple servers, ensuring that no single database becomes a bottleneck. This approach can help your payment systems maintain speed and efficiency, even as transaction volumes increase.

Use Asynchronous Communication for Robustness

Asynchronous communication is a powerful tool that can significantly enhance the robustness of your payment system. By employing message queues like Kafka or RabbitMQ, you can decouple services, allowing them to operate independently and efficiently. For example, when a user initiates a payment, the request can be sent to a queue and the payment processing service can pick it up when it’s ready. This means your system isn’t held up by any single process, which is particularly important during peak times when transaction volumes soar.

Asynchronous communication also enhances error handling. When a service runs into a problem while processing a payment, it can easily send a message to a retry queue without disrupting the user experience. This proactive method helps your payment system bounce back from temporary issues, leading to a more dependable service overall. By incorporating these strategies, you'll build a PayPal design system that not only meets today’s needs but is also flexible enough to grow with future demands.

Secure Your Payment Systems with PayPal Design Best Practices

When designing payment systems, security should be a top priority in every decision made. PayPal's Design System highlights best practices that safeguard the integrity and confidentiality of transactions. By following these guidelines, sensitive information is protected and user trust is fostered, which is incredibly important in today’s online environment. A mix of clear directions and strong technological solutions can create a safe space for both the platform and its users.

A secure payment system relies heavily on following industry standards like PCI DSS. These security guidelines are specifically created to safeguard card information during and after financial transactions. By making sure your payment systems meet PCI DSS requirements, you’re taking important steps to protect user data from potential breaches. This involves using encryption, maintaining a secure network, and regularly checking your systems for any vulnerabilities. Tokenization is also essential in this security approach. Instead of keeping sensitive card details, tokenization swaps them out for a unique identifier or token that cannot be traced back to the original data. This significantly lowers the chances of data theft because even if a hacker manages to access your database, they won’t find any usable card information.

Apply PCI DSS Compliance and Tokenization

Implementing PCI DSS compliance isn't just about checking off a list; it's really about fostering a security-focused culture within your organization. Regular training for employees on security protocols and the significance of safeguarding customer data can make a big difference. Plus, performing regular audits and vulnerability assessments helps spot potential weaknesses before they turn into bigger problems.

Tokenization acts as an extra layer of protection. By ensuring that sensitive information is never stored in its original form, you minimize the risk associated with data breaches. If a hacker were to access your system, they’d only find tokens, which hold no real value. This approach not only increases security but also simplifies compliance with regulations, making it easier to manage sensitive information while maintaining user trust.

Integrate Fraud Detection and Multi-Factor Authentication

Let’s explore the essential topic of fraud detection, something every payment system needs to prioritize. PayPal uses advanced algorithms and machine learning to analyze transaction patterns and identify suspicious activities. By integrating these fraud detection tools, you can detect potential threats in real-time, which allows for quicker action when irregularities arise. This proactive approach helps reduce losses and keeps customers safe.

Multi-factor authentication (MFA) is an essential part of securing payment systems. It adds an extra layer of verification, so even if someone gets hold of a user’s password, they still can’t access the account without another form of authentication. This could be a text message confirmation, an email verification, or even something like a fingerprint scan. By implementing MFA, the chances of unauthorized access drop significantly, making it much harder for fraudsters to succeed.

By prioritizing security through best practices like PCI DSS compliance, tokenization, fraud detection, and multi-factor authentication, you can build a payment system that not only protects your users but also enhances your brand's credibility. These measures are not just technical requirements; they are fundamental to creating a seamless and trustworthy payment experience.

Conclusion

The PayPal Design System acts as a robust framework for crafting smooth and secure payment experiences.

By focusing on key elements such as typography, color palette and motion design, it enhances usability while reinforcing brand identity.

Implementing this design system, alongside tools like UXPin Merge, facilitates effective collaboration between designers and developers, ensuring consistency and efficiency.

Focusing on security by adopting best practices like PCI DSS compliance and multi-factor authentication really helps to establish trust with users.

Embracing the PayPal Design System allows businesses to provide payment solutions that are user-friendly, dependable and secure, catering to the changing needs of their customers.